**Role Overview:**
As an Early Years Educator, you'll play a key role in creating a warm, welcoming, and inclusive atmosphere for children aged 0-5 years. You'll work closely with their experienced team to plan and deliver engaging activities that promote learning and development, while ensuring the safety and well-being of all children in your care.
**Key Responsibilities:**
- Planning and implementing age-appropriate activities
- Building positive relationships with children, parents, and colleagues
- Observing and recording children's progress
- Ensuring a safe and stimulating environment at all times
- Supporting children's personal, social, and emotional development
- Collaborating with colleagues to maintain high standards of care and education
**Requirements:**
- Level 2 or Level 3 qualification in Early Years Education or equivalent
- Previous experience working in a nursery setting
- Knowledge of the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ework
- Strong communication and teamwork skills
- A genuine passion for working with young children
